目的探讨创伤性休克对兔肾组织不同时相中性粒细胞明胶酶相关脂质运载蛋白(NGAL)、肾损伤分子-1(Kim-1)与热休克蛋白70(HSP70)表达的影响。方法健康新西兰大白兔30只,随机分为对照组、0 h模型组、6 h模型组、12 h模型组和24 h模型组,每组6只。通过酶联免疫吸附法(ELISA)、蛋白质印迹法(Western-blot)与实时荧光定量聚合酶链反应(Real-time PCR)测定各组兔血液、尿液及肾组织中NGAL、Kim-1、HSP70的含量与mRNA的表达变化。结果与对照组比较,模型组各时相血液及尿液中NGAL、Kim-1及HSP70含量均升高,6 h开始增加,24 h时有所恢复,但仍为高表达,差异有统计学意义(P<0.05)。与对照组比较,模型组兔肾组织在不同时相NGAL、Kim-1及HSP70表达量均显著升高,在6 h时升高最明显,差异均有统计学意义(P<0.05)。结论 NGAL、Kim-1、HSP70与创伤性休克导致肾损伤的发生和发展相关。监测血液、尿液及肾组织中NGAL、Kim-1及HSP70的变化情况,有助于对创伤性休克导致肾损伤的判断和治疗。
